The action takes place across 40 paylines on a 5x4 reel set. It’s a pretty straightforward slot with a familiar layout. All the controls are in their usual spots, and the visuals are pretty solid, with lifelike pics of the characters. The soundtrack will keep you on your toes, so you’ll feel like you’ve been transported straight to Isla Nublar.
The movie characters are premiums, paying up to 10x for five of a kind wins. The wild can step in to complete winning combinations, paying 2x or 5x in the base game when it does. It’s also the highest paying symbol in Jurassic Park Gold, offering wins up to 125x the bet for five.
There aren’t many features in the base game except for the Link & Win mechanic. It is triggered by six Powerball symbols. When they land on the reels, they turn into sticky symbols. Once the feature starts, every Powerball that lands turns sticky as well, resetting the number of Link & Win respins to three. Landing 15, 20, 25, or 30 Powerballs will also unlock extra rows on the grid. These come with random cash prizes and jackpots, of which the Mega jackpot pays the maximum of 8,000x the bet.
The majority of slots have one bonus round, Jurassic Park Gold has three. They’re all free spins rounds with different modes unlocked after a certain number of retriggers. The bonus is triggered by three scatters in sight.
If you manage to collect 15 scatter pairs in the Wild Storm meter, you get the T-Rex feature. It’s a single free spin with a guaranteed Wild Storm trigger, turning 1 to 5 reels fully wild.
Finally, the Wild Chase feature can trigger the T-Rex round. If you land a wild in the highlighted position during it, it will cover the whole reel, almost guaranteed big wins.
